TSUKIOKA KOGYO (1869-1927). Two prints, surimono, shikishiban, Rat nibbling a radish and Mandarin ducks and plum blossom. Signed Kogyo and stamped Toshihisa and Kogyo. Publisher Matsuki Heikichi. Rehauts of gofun. (Bends, cut, slightly insolated, top corner glued, small tears, lined) Length 23 cm - Width 24 cm Attached : A set of yellow and red paper TALISMANS used in Taoist temples, printed with images of Taoist deities and incantations, China. Reference: Two similar prints in the British Museum, no. 1946,0209,0.125 and 1906,1220,0.1676. These two surimono are part of a series of fifty kacho-e (flowers and birds) produced by Kogyo mainly for export.
